[PATCH] x86: reduce dependencies on x86_emulate/x86_emulate.h

Split out struct x86_event to an entirely separate header, and move a few
other items describing the architecture to a new x86-types.h. With a few
forward decls of structures and with a fair number of new #include-s in
.c files, the inclusion of x86_emulate.h (and hence
x86_emulate/x86_emulate.h) can be dropped from all header files except
hvm/emulate.h; it needs additionally adding to hvm/ioreq.h though.

The use in drivers/vpci/msix.c is certainly somewhat bogus, but as long as
X86EMUL_OKAY etc are used directly there, that's the way to go. Like done
for IOREQ, some abstraction will be needed here if this file was to be
re-used by non-x86.

--- /dev/null
+++ b/xen/arch/x86/include/asm/x86-types.h
@@ -0,0 +1,76 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-or-later */
+/*
+ * x86-types.h
+ *
+ * Type definitions and basic helpers which are more or less directly
+ * describing aspects of the architecture.
+ */
+
+#ifndef X86_X86_TYPES_H
+#define X86_X86_TYPES_H
+
+#ifdef __XEN__
+# include <xen/types.h>
+#else
+# include <stdint.h>
+#endif
+
+/*
+ * Comprehensive enumeration of x86 segment registers.  Various bits of code
+ * rely on this order (general purpose before system, tr at the beginning of
+ * system).
+ */
+enum x86_segment {
+    /* General purpose.  Matches the SReg3 encoding in opcode/ModRM bytes. */
+    x86_seg_es,
+    x86_seg_cs,
+    x86_seg_ss,
+    x86_seg_ds,
+    x86_seg_fs,
+    x86_seg_gs,
+    /* System: Valid to use for implicit table references. */
+    x86_seg_tr,
+    x86_seg_ldtr,
+    x86_seg_gdtr,
+    x86_seg_idtr,
+    /* No Segment: For (system/normal) accesses which are already linear. */
+    x86_seg_sys,
+    x86_seg_none
+};
+
+static inline bool is_x86_user_segment(enum x86_segment seg)
+{
+    unsigned int idx = seg;
+
+    return idx <= x86_seg_gs;
+}
+static inline bool is_x86_system_segment(enum x86_segment seg)
+{
+    return seg >= x86_seg_tr && seg < x86_seg_none;
+}
+
+/*
+ * Full state of a segment register (visible and hidden portions).
+ * Chosen to match the format of an AMD SVM VMCB.
+ */
+struct segment_register {
+    uint16_t   sel;
+    union {
+        uint16_t attr;
+        struct {
+            uint16_t type:4;
+            uint16_t s:   1;
+            uint16_t dpl: 2;
+            uint16_t p:   1;
+            uint16_t avl: 1;
+            uint16_t l:   1;
+            uint16_t db:  1;
+            uint16_t g:   1;
+            uint16_t pad: 4;
+        };
+    };
+    uint32_t   limit;
+    uint64_t   base;
+};
+
+#endif	/* X86_X86_TYPES_H */
